Output 93b523226c5a3012236af4a1c25efefddb01d9d5dc1c79677f7b682bb9621e77:1

value
3587168311
script pubkey
OP_0 OP_PUSHBYTES_20 2620afb92aa4b894c50024906cea4de677d3d67b
address
ltc1qycs2lwf25juff3gqyjgxe6jduema84nm5v5l2n
transaction
93b523226c5a3012236af4a1c25efefddb01d9d5dc1c79677f7b682bb9621e77
spent
true